A patient admitted in a state of extreme anxiety has vital signs of T 98.6°F (37°C) P 81 BP 130/86 R 32. What will result if this hyperventilation continues?
- A. Metabolic acidosis
- B. Metabolic alkalosis
- C. Respiratory acidosis
- D. Respiratory alkalosis
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Respiratory alkalosis is caused by hyperventilation as the lungs blow off large amounts of CO2.

Electrolytes are not measured by weight; their chemical activity is expressed in milliequivalents. What does 1 mEq of potassium have the same combining power as?
- A. 1 mEq of nitrogen
- B. 1 mEq of oxygen
- C. 1 mEq of hydrogen
- D. 1 mEq of magnesium
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Electrolytes are measured in milliequivalents: 1 mEq of any electrolyte is equal to 1 mEq of hydrogen.

The nurse expects an adult with normal __ function to void a minimum of 120 mL of urine in 4 hours.
Correct Answer: kidney
Rationale: The norm is to excrete at least 30 mL/h. In 4 hours, the urine output is expected to be 120 mL.
The nurse must keep an accurate intake and output record to assess kidney efficiency. In order for the kidneys to remove waste what is the least amount of hourly urine output the kidneys must produce to remove waste?
- A. 10 mL
- B. 20 mL
- C. 30 mL
- D. 40 mL
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: The kidneys must excrete a minimum of 30 mL/h to eliminate waste products.
The nurse is educating a patient regarding the need to avoid foods high in potassium. What food choices led the nurse to conclude that teaching was not effective?
- A. Apples and green beans
- B. Kiwis and onions
- C. Apricots and asparagus
- D. Grapes and lima beans
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Apricots and asparagus are potassium-rich.
